Table A shows normative data for male 15 year olds for three common tests. Use the table and read off: a 30 m sprint time of 4.35 seconds, a vertical jump of 44 cm, and a sit-and-reach of 28 cm. For each score, state the performance rating band from Table A.

Table A, male age 15 normative bands
30 m sprint time: Excellent ≤ 4.20 s, Good 4.21-4.50 s, Average 4.51-4.80 s, Below average > 4.80 s
Vertical jump height: Excellent ≥ 50 cm, Good 45-49 cm, Average 40-44 cm, Below average < 40 cm
Sit-and-reach flexibility: Excellent ≥ 35 cm, Good 30-34 cm, Average 25-29 cm, Below average < 25 cm

Table B shows normative bands for female aged 17. Use Table B to rate two scores: a 30 m sprint time of 5.20 seconds and a sit-and-reach score of 33 cm.

Table B, female age 17 normative bands
30 m sprint time: Excellent ≤ 4.80 s, Good 4.81-5.10 s, Average 5.11-5.40 s, Below average > 5.40 s
Sit-and-reach flexibility: Excellent ≥ 36 cm, Good 31-35 cm, Average 26-30 cm, Below average < 26 cm
